U.S. and UK to punish Putin’s elite friends if Russia invades Ukraine

Published by
Reuters UK

By Steve Holland, Guy Faulconbridge and Dmitry Antonov WASHINGTON/LONDON/MOSCOW (Reuters) -The United States and the United Kingdom are prepared to punish Russian elites close to President Vladimir Putin with asset freezes and travel bans if Russia sends troops into Ukraine, the White House and British government said on Monday.
